Express Publications (Madurai) Private Limited is the flagship company of The New Indian Express Group and is publishing Newspapers and Periodicals in the States of Tamil Nadu, Andhra Pradesh, Telengana, Karnataka, Kerala, Orissa and Union Territories of Puducherry, Andaman and Nicobar Islands, Yanam and Lakshdweep. It brings out its publication of newspapers and periodicals from 33 Centres. It also has Marketing Offices in Kolkata, Mumbai and New Delhi. The Company's publications include English Dailies viz. The New Indian Express and The Morning Standard and Sunday editions The Sunday Express and The Sunday Standard . The Morning Standard and The Sunday Standard are published from New Delhi. The company also brings out Tamil daily Dinamani and Samakalika Malayalam Varika, a weekly magazine in Malayalam. The Company's publications are popular and command large readership.
